Description

Still red Saint-Émilion 1er Grand Cru Classé, 14.5% ABV, produced by Chateau La Gaffeliere. Blend: 60% Merlot, 40% Cabernet Franc. 0.75L bottle, 2019 vintage. A Bordeaux wine that embodies the excellence and tradition of Saint-Émilion, with a prestigious classification that attests to its superior quality. Château La Gaffelière in Saint-Émilion has a long and rich winemaking history dating back to the Gallo-Roman period. Aromas of cassis and plum jam, followed by chalky and mineral notes. Ruby red with violet reflections. Full-bodied, extraordinarily pure, with velvety tannins and a long finish.
